Meanwhile, the Nifty 50 index was down 203.45 points, or 0.82% at 24,685.25.
BPCL (down 2.59%), HPCL (down 2.24%) and Indian Oil Corporation (down 1.2%) edged lower.
The heightened geopolitical unrest has sparked fears of potential disruptions to global oil supplies. Higher crude oil prices could increase under-recoveries of PSU OMCs on domestic sale of LPG and kerosene at controlled prices. The government has freed pricing of petrol and diesel.
